There are times when the sale is simply fun because of the history or the house. This beautiful old family home sitting on over 20 acres in the center of town is a perfect location for a fun sale. The current family has owned it for about 50 years but it is still referred to as the Alford home because of the many years it was owned by that family. When the original family contacted the estate sale company regarding furniture and some decorative items that they had stored, it became a really good exercise to combine the original items in with the current family’s possessions.
Having a two dining tables and chairs in the main dining room may look strange, but I would eat there. Seeing the armoire and three sofas in the receiving room only means that a lot of people could have sat there. Two extra dining areas in the solarium is only unusual if you don’t like having meals in various places. Yes, it is over-furnished, but you will have a good time shopping with all this variety:
